#![allow(clippy::unwrap_used, clippy::expect_used)]
|
|
use anyhow::Context;
|
|
use core_test_support::test_codex_exec::test_codex_exec;
|
|
use serde_json::Value;
|
|
use std::path::Path;
|
|
use std::string::ToString;
|
|
use uuid::Uuid;
|
|
use walkdir::WalkDir;
|
|
|
|
/// Utility: scan the sessions dir for a rollout file that contains `marker`
|
|
/// in any response_item.message.content entry. Returns the absolute path.
|
|
fn find_session_file_containing_marker(
|
|
sessions_dir: &std::path::Path,
|
|
marker: &str,
|
|
) -> Option<std::path::PathBuf> {
|
|
for entry in WalkDir::new(sessions_dir) {
|
|
let entry = match entry {
|
|
Ok(e) => e,
|
|
Err(_) => continue,
|
|
};
|
|
if !entry.file_type().is_file() {
|
|
continue;
|
|
}
|
|
if !entry.file_name().to_string_lossy().ends_with(".jsonl") {
|
|
continue;
|
|
}
|
|
let path = entry.path();
|
|
let Ok(content) = std::fs::read_to_string(path) else {
|
|
continue;
|
|
};
|
|
// Skip the first meta line and scan remaining JSONL entries.
|
|
let mut lines = content.lines();
|
|
if lines.next().is_none() {
|
|
continue;
|
|
}
|
|
for line in lines {
|
|
if line.trim().is_empty() {
|
|
continue;
|
|
}
|
|
let Ok(item): Result<Value, _> = serde_json::from_str(line) else {
|
|
continue;
|
|
};
|
|
if item.get("type").and_then(|t| t.as_str()) == Some("response_item")
|
|
&& let Some(payload) = item.get("payload")
|
|
&& payload.get("type").and_then(|t| t.as_str()) == Some("message")
|
|
&& payload
|
|
.get("content")
|
|
.map(ToString::to_string)
|
|
.unwrap_or_default()
|
|
.contains(marker)
|
|
{
|
|
return Some(path.to_path_buf());
|
|
}
|
|
}
|
|
}
|
|
None
|
|
}
|
|
|
|
/// Extract the conversation UUID from the first SessionMeta line in the rollout file.
|
|
fn extract_conversation_id(path: &std::path::Path) -> String {
|
|
let content = std::fs::read_to_string(path).unwrap();
|
|
let mut lines = content.lines();
|
|
let meta_line = lines.next().expect("missing meta line");
|
|
let meta: Value = serde_json::from_str(meta_line).expect("invalid meta json");
|
|
meta.get("payload")
|
|
.and_then(|p| p.get("id"))
|
|
.and_then(|v| v.as_str())
|
|
.unwrap_or_default()
|
|
.to_string()
|
|
}
|
|
|
|
#[test]
|
|
fn exec_resume_last_appends_to_existing_file() -> anyhow::Result<()> {
|
|
let test = test_codex_exec();
|
|
let fixture =
|
|
Path::new(env!("CARGO_MANIFEST_DIR")).join("tests/fixtures/cli_responses_fixture.sse");
|
|
|
|
// 1) First run: create a session with a unique marker in the content.
|
|
let marker = format!("resume-last-{}", Uuid::new_v4());
|
|
let prompt = format!("echo {marker}");
|
|
|
|
test.cmd()
|
|
.env("CODEX_RS_SSE_FIXTURE", &fixture)
|
|
.env("OPENAI_BASE_URL", "http://unused.local")
|
|
.arg("--skip-git-repo-check")
|
|
.arg("-C")
|
|
.arg(env!("CARGO_MANIFEST_DIR"))
|
|
.arg(&prompt)
|
|
.assert()
|
|
.success();
|
|
|
|
// Find the created session file containing the marker.
|
|
let sessions_dir = test.home_path().join("sessions");
|
|
let path = find_session_file_containing_marker(&sessions_dir, &marker)
|
|
.expect("no session file found after first run");
|
|
|
|
// 2) Second run: resume the most recent file with a new marker.
|
|
let marker2 = format!("resume-last-2-{}", Uuid::new_v4());
|
|
let prompt2 = format!("echo {marker2}");
|
|
|
|
test.cmd()
|
|
.env("CODEX_RS_SSE_FIXTURE", &fixture)
|
|
.env("OPENAI_BASE_URL", "http://unused.local")
|
|
.arg("--skip-git-repo-check")
|
|
.arg("-C")
|
|
.arg(env!("CARGO_MANIFEST_DIR"))
|
|
.arg(&prompt2)
|
|
.arg("resume")
|
|
.arg("--last")
|
|
.assert()
|
|
.success();
|
|
|
|
// Ensure the same file was updated and contains both markers.
|
|
let resumed_path = find_session_file_containing_marker(&sessions_dir, &marker2)
|
|
.expect("no resumed session file containing marker2");
|
|
assert_eq!(
|
|
resumed_path, path,
|
|
"resume --last should append to existing file"
|
|
);
|
|
let content = std::fs::read_to_string(&resumed_path)?;
|
|
assert!(content.contains(&marker));
|
|
assert!(content.contains(&marker2));
|
|
Ok(())
|
|
}
|
|
|
|
#[test]
|
|
fn exec_resume_by_id_appends_to_existing_file() -> anyhow::Result<()> {
|
|
let test = test_codex_exec();
|
|
let fixture =
|
|
Path::new(env!("CARGO_MANIFEST_DIR")).join("tests/fixtures/cli_responses_fixture.sse");
|
|
|
|
// 1) First run: create a session
|
|
let marker = format!("resume-by-id-{}", Uuid::new_v4());
|
|
let prompt = format!("echo {marker}");
|
|
|
|
test.cmd()
|
|
.env("CODEX_RS_SSE_FIXTURE", &fixture)
|
|
.env("OPENAI_BASE_URL", "http://unused.local")
|
|
.arg("--skip-git-repo-check")
|
|
.arg("-C")
|
|
.arg(env!("CARGO_MANIFEST_DIR"))
|
|
.arg(&prompt)
|
|
.assert()
|
|
.success();
|
|
|
|
let sessions_dir = test.home_path().join("sessions");
|
|
let path = find_session_file_containing_marker(&sessions_dir, &marker)
|
|
.expect("no session file found after first run");
|
|
let session_id = extract_conversation_id(&path);
|
|
assert!(
|
|
!session_id.is_empty(),
|
|
"missing conversation id in meta line"
|
|
);
|
|
|
|
// 2) Resume by id
|
|
let marker2 = format!("resume-by-id-2-{}", Uuid::new_v4());
|
|
let prompt2 = format!("echo {marker2}");
|
|
|
|
test.cmd()
|
|
.env("CODEX_RS_SSE_FIXTURE", &fixture)
|
|
.env("OPENAI_BASE_URL", "http://unused.local")
|
|
.arg("--skip-git-repo-check")
|
|
.arg("-C")
|
|
.arg(env!("CARGO_MANIFEST_DIR"))
|
|
.arg(&prompt2)
|
|
.arg("resume")
|
|
.arg(&session_id)
|
|
.assert()
|
|
.success();
|
|
|
|
let resumed_path = find_session_file_containing_marker(&sessions_dir, &marker2)
|
|
.expect("no resumed session file containing marker2");
|
|
assert_eq!(
|
|
resumed_path, path,
|
|
"resume by id should append to existing file"
|
|
);
|
|
let content = std::fs::read_to_string(&resumed_path)?;
|
|
assert!(content.contains(&marker));
|
|
assert!(content.contains(&marker2));
|
|
Ok(())
|
|
}
|
|
|
|
#[test]
|
|
fn exec_resume_preserves_cli_configuration_overrides() -> anyhow::Result<()> {
|
|
let test = test_codex_exec();
|
|
let fixture =
|
|
Path::new(env!("CARGO_MANIFEST_DIR")).join("tests/fixtures/cli_responses_fixture.sse");
|
|
|
|
let marker = format!("resume-config-{}", Uuid::new_v4());
|
|
let prompt = format!("echo {marker}");
|
|
|
|
test.cmd()
|
|
.env("CODEX_RS_SSE_FIXTURE", &fixture)
|
|
.env("OPENAI_BASE_URL", "http://unused.local")
|
|
.arg("--skip-git-repo-check")
|
|
.arg("--sandbox")
|
|
.arg("workspace-write")
|
|
.arg("--model")
|
|
.arg("gpt-5")
|
|
.arg("-C")
|
|
.arg(env!("CARGO_MANIFEST_DIR"))
|
|
.arg(&prompt)
|
|
.assert()
|
|
.success();
|
|
|
|
let sessions_dir = test.home_path().join("sessions");
|
|
let path = find_session_file_containing_marker(&sessions_dir, &marker)
|
|
.expect("no session file found after first run");
|
|
|
|
let marker2 = format!("resume-config-2-{}", Uuid::new_v4());
|
|
let prompt2 = format!("echo {marker2}");
|
|
|
|
let output = test
|
|
.cmd()
|
|
.env("CODEX_RS_SSE_FIXTURE", &fixture)
|
|
.env("OPENAI_BASE_URL", "http://unused.local")
|
|
.arg("--skip-git-repo-check")
|
|
.arg("--sandbox")
|
|
.arg("workspace-write")
|
|
.arg("--model")
|
|
.arg("gpt-5-high")
|
|
.arg("-C")
|
|
.arg(env!("CARGO_MANIFEST_DIR"))
|
|
.arg(&prompt2)
|
|
.arg("resume")
|
|
.arg("--last")
|
|
.output()
|
|
.context("resume run should succeed")?;
|
|
|
|
assert!(output.status.success(), "resume run failed: {output:?}");
|
|
|
|
let stdout = String::from_utf8(output.stdout)?;
|
|
assert!(
|
|
stdout.contains("model: gpt-5-high"),
|
|
"stdout missing model override: {stdout}"
|
|
);
|
|
assert!(
|
|
stdout.contains("sandbox: workspace-write"),
|
|
"stdout missing sandbox override: {stdout}"
|
|
);
|
|
|
|
let resumed_path = find_session_file_containing_marker(&sessions_dir, &marker2)
|
|
.expect("no resumed session file containing marker2");
|
|
assert_eq!(resumed_path, path, "resume should append to same file");
|
|
|
|
let content = std::fs::read_to_string(&resumed_path)?;
|
|
assert!(content.contains(&marker));
|
|
assert!(content.contains(&marker2));
|
|
Ok(())
|
|
}
